Fairfield, CA (April 10, 2026) –  In a powerful example of student leadership and community partnership, Fairfield High School’s Class of 2027 leadership students hosted a “Prom Dress Giveaway” on Saturday, March 28th, opening their doors to students from across Solano County and beyond. The event was led by Fairfield High’s Class of 2027 co-leadership advisors Lynn Bocca and Sherry Nelson, as well as the efforts to manage set up and break down by two volunteers from the leadership class of 2028 - Dani Bocca and Alexia Weiss. 

Held in the Fairfield High School (FHS) library, the event welcomed students from Armijo, Rodriguez, Fairfield, and Vanden High Schools, as well as neighboring districts including Vacaville Unified, Benicia Unified, and American Canyon. By the end of the day, more than 75 prom dresses had been distributed – along with makeup bags, shoes, handbags, and jewelry – helping ensure that every student could feel confident and celebrated on their special night.

The giveaway was a joint effort between the leadership students at FHS and the Tau Upsilon Omega Chapter of Alpha KappaAlpha Sorority, inc, whose partnership helped bring the vision to life.
